Sotatercept will be associated with the following:\n\n1. Improvement in capillary blush, reduce the tapering and tortuosity of affected vessels on pulmonary wedge angiography and decreased wall thickness on intravascular ultrasound in previously affected areas.\n2. Improvement in previously poorly or non-perfused areas rather than increased perfusion to previously perfused areas.\n3. No changes in baseline ventilation and improvement and ventilation\u002Fperfusion matching.",[24,25],"Pulmonary Arterial Hypertension (PAH)","Pulmonary Hypertension","NOT_YET_RECRUITING","2026-03-17",{"date":29,"type":30},"2026-03-23","ACTUAL",{"date":32,"type":20},"2026-03-15",{"date":34,"type":20},"2028-06-15",{"name":36,"class":37},"Franz Rischard, DO","OTHER",""]
